studies at the Polytechnic University of Milan (Italy) with a Laurea degree (equivalent to BEng plus MEng) and a PhD in Nuclear Engineering, with specialty in nuclear thermal-hydraulics. Successively, he completed a MSc in Mathematics at the University of Pavia (Italy), with specialty in computational fluid dynamics.<\/p><p style=\"margin-bottom: 0.9rem;color: #545454;font-family: Tahoma, sans-serif;font-size: 15px\">After graduating, he started his career as Senior Engineer\/Scientist for the nuclear vendor Westinghouse Electric Company in Pittsburgh (USA), where he worked on transient\/safety analysis of water-cooled nuclear power plants and on the thermal-hydraulic design\/testing of small-modular water-cooled nuclear reactor systems. Successively, he moved to the Chalmers University of Technology in Gothenburg (Sweden) and then to the Swiss Federal Institute of Technology (EPFL) in Lausanne (Switzerland), where he spent six years working as Post-Doctoral Researcher on macro-micro-scale two-phase flow modelling for demanding cooling applications (nuclear fission\/fusion reactors, microelectronics systems, and high-energy physics particle detectors). He joined the University of Manchester (UK) in 2013 as Lecturer in Thermal-Hydraulics, and was successively promoted to Senior Lecturer in 2018 and then to Reader in 2021. He joined the Guangdong Technion-Israel Institute of Technology in Shantou (China) in 2022 as Associate Professor.<\/p><p style=\"margin-bottom: 0.9rem;color: #545454;font-family: Tahoma, sans-serif;font-size: 15px\">He has been associated with over USD18M research funding (USD570k as personal credit) and has been PI in two research grants funded by EPSRC-Engineering and Physical Science Research Council (UK). He has authored\/coauthored 1 book, 2 book chapters, and over 100 refereed papers in journals and conferences. He is Associate Editor of the Journal of Mechanical Engineering Science (Proc. IMechE) since 2020.<\/p><p style=\"margin-bottom: 0.9rem;color: #545454;font-family: Tahoma, sans-serif;font-size: 15px\">He has taught Heat Transfer, Fluid Mechanics, Advanced Engineering Fluid Mechanics, Numerical Methods in Heat Transfer, Introduction to Scientific and Engineering Calculations, and Probability and Statistics in Mechanical Engineering.
